A gastric diverter and an antibacterial digestive tract catheter thereof. The catheter comprises a membrane tube (31). One end of the membrane tube (31) is connected to a stent (32). The membrane tube (31) is made of an antibacterial material. The membrane tube (31) has an outer diameter of 10-35 mm, and a wall thickness of 0.001-0.3 mm. The membrane tube (31) is fixedly connected to the stent (32) by means of stitching, hot pressing, ultrasonic welding, or laser welding. The antibacterial digestive tract catheter is made of an antibacterial material to minimize occurrences of intestinal inflammation, and to ameliorate metabolic diseases, while also avoiding complications such as liver abscess and pancreatitis. Thus, the invention provides a safer and more effective medical instrument for the treatment of metabolic diseases such as diabetes.
